Create Child Handling Unit in existing packaging hierarchy

I am looking for a "SAP standard way" of doing this process. Handling Unit Management has been configured and is already being used.

 

Current Scenario:

 

We use Handling Units already during "production".

 

Material Quantity~: 150 KG (simplified example. In reality, we talking about tons)

Packaging instructions: Pallet (100 KG) -> Boxes (10 KG) -> Actual Material

 

Using Transaction, COWBPACK, the system will automatically propose a hierarchy based on the packaging instructions:

- 1 Pallet (100 KG) and 10 Boxes

- 1 Pallet (50 GK) and 5 Boxes

 

There can be cases that there is more material than originally planned. In this case, we want to put additional Box(es) on the existing 2nd Pallet (because it is a partial pallet).

 

If I just redo COWBPACK, the system will create one additional pallet with one BOX. But this is not what I want.

 

How can I create a new Handling Unit for a new Box and assign it to an existing Pallet?

 

My current approach is to create a new Pallet with one Box and than re-pack the Box to the partial Pallet (2nd Pallet). However, this is far from a good approach...
